The Company

BEAT THE BOMB is the next generation of immersive group entertainment, where customers step into real-life video games. We use an innovative digital, interactive game system to reimagine the intersection of technology and human social connection. In our classic Mission experience, teams wearing hazmat suits go through a series of interactive game rooms, including a laser maze, before facing the World's Largest Paint Bomb Our original Brooklyn location opened in 2018. We now have locations in Atlanta and Washington D.C. We've hosted over 300,000 players including hundreds of corporate team building outings, school groups, and non-profit organizations. Beat The Bomb is one of the highest rated experiences in all 3 markets. We offer a full range of special event services including STEM Camps, Kid and Adult Birthday parties, Corporate Tournaments, and Bachelorette parties. We also have a virtual team building platform called Beat The Bomb Virtual, serving remote teams across the globe. Our #1 goal is to ensure every player has a BLAST

The DC Location

Located in DC's hippest new neighborhood, Ivy City, DC, this marks our third location in the nation, and opened in February 2023. The 10,000+ square foot location offers our classic Mission experiences with glass-walled bomb rooms; 7 immersive arcade lounges ('Game Bays'); street food and a full selection of beer, wine, cocktails & signature slushies @ The Bomb Bar; a beer garden with sports viewing; and several dedicated private event spaces for large groups. The Bomb DC has already emerged as one of the highest rated experiences in DC with over 5,000 5-star reviews on Google and has welcomed nearly 50,000 customers in less than 6 months.
